            does the cylinder head have two indented holes in it?

            if so use some nose pliers and insert one part into each hole, then twist in an anti clockwise mannor until ut unscews

            altenrativly you can buy a tool for it, or use an allen key in one hole and have the the shaft of it pull arround the cylinder head nozzle.... i would rather use the plier nose trick though as its safer or buy a propper tool for it (no point though as nose plier work).
